Members of the Senate Commerce, Science, and Transportation Committee heard testimony on the Space Shuttle Columbia explosion, as well as recommendations for the future of space policy. In his testimony Admiral Harold Gehman was critical of NASA’s safety office and said that wide-ranging changes were needed before the shuttle program should be allowed to operate. close
